Subject: Loyalty Overhaul — Quick Update

Hi all,

The Sunward Rewards revamp is moving. We're folding the old points tiers into a single flat-rate scheme and adding partner perks through Calloway Cafés. Pilot starts in the Greybourne stores next month; full rollout to follow if redemption rates hold up. Shout if your team spots issues. Context on the wider plan sits in the note below.

confidential, kahag-fafof: Pelixax Holdings is in early talks to buy Praixox Group for about $24.9 million. The Oliir launch date is March 8, and nothing goes to the press before then.

## Deployment

Routewright, the pick-list optimizer, deploys as a single container behind the internal gateway and holds no long-lived credentials; warehouse data access goes through short-lived tokens issued at startup. It listens only on the service mesh, writes no customer data to disk, and logs are scrubbed of order identifiers before shipping. TLS is terminated at the gateway, with mutual auth between the optimizer and the inventory service. All tunables are injected via environment at deploy time; the production values are as follows.

config for kajog-tadug:
[casax]
port = 11211
region = west-3
host = casax.nelvroworks.internal
timeout_ms = 5000
retries = 7

Handover Note — Cash-Flow Forecast, Q4

To the branch managers of Fenlow & Carrick: as I transfer responsibilities to Director Ysolde Marren, please note the Q4 forecast assumes steady receipts from the Bramleigh contract and a 5% rise in operating outflows. Variances above 2% must be reported weekly. The forward assumptions tied to our plans are detailed in the note below.

board note of kageg-bahof: The renewal with Holwynax Holdings closes at $2 million a year, 5 percent below the last contract. Project Ulaath slips by two quarters because of the supplier delay.

Build Provenance: Driver-Assignment Heuristic (Ferrowave Dispatch). New team members should know the heuristic's weights are baked into each build, not fetched at runtime, so behavior differences between environments almost always trace to build lineage. Every release embeds the source commit, the weight-table revision, and the training snapshot date. Before filing any assignment-quality bug, verify which artifact the node is running using the provenance stamp recorded below.

trace token, fafog-kageg: htk4_98e6